Cinderella Bridal Shoot Part 2

New images from the Cinderella Bridal shoot part 2, featured on Lovemydress.net. Check out the website for more images from the shoot!

Alex wanted a strong look for Lizzie in this part of the shoot. I went with a strong dark smoky eye, to give the look a real rock chic feel. Using a black khol pencil and MAC Carbon eyeshadow, all over the lid. I then worked the pigment out to the outer corners of the eyes to give the look a winged out eye effect, bringing the eye make-up look up to date a little more. For the lips I decided to got for an neutral pinky tone Lancome French Touch L’absolu 310 from the limited edition Ultra Lavande collection worked perfectly.

Kaz created Lizzies hair with really big and bouncy curls to add to the styling. Using heated rollers to create the curl, then frizing it out made her hair into mane of curls! It looked amazing!

Bridal make-up for spring

After working on a creative bridal shoot a few weekends ago, it has inspired me to write a quick blog on the top 3 things I think look beautiful  for spring.

Dewy flawless skin

Most brides like to look like a more beautiful version of themselves on their wedding day. A dewy flawless foundation base is perfect for a bridal look. Bobbi Brown Skin Foundation SPF 15 is a fantastic foundation to get this look! Covers all manor of sins without looking heavy at all. When I first used this I thought the consistency was a little thin, however it literally goes on like a second skin and it feels breathable and light. Add a little luminator to the contors of your cheeks, this will highlight your cheekbones giving your face more structure.

Glowing cheeks

Don’t over do it with the blusher. Use a cream blush like Nars Cream Blush in Penny Lane just to give your cheeks a little pop of colour.  Place the blush on the apple of your cheeks, this will give you a really nice flushed look. Be careful not to over do it though otherwise you could end up looking like a doll!

Nude lips

Nude lips are big this season, gives your lips a kissable look without being over done. Try MAC Lipgelee in Bubble lounge for a soft pinky nude tone.
